Offers a stunning photographic experience for mirrorless users, the Sigma 65mm F2.0 DG DN Contemporary Lens for Leica L is a stylishly sleek short telephoto prime offering a unique field of view well-suited to portraiture and selective everyday shooting. It allows a slightly more compressed perspective than standard lenses, opening up a variety of creative approaches for both photography and filmmaking. It can capture extremely fine detail even wide open at its maximum aperture of F2 and produces large and round bokeh.
Furthermore, a bright f/2 design that helps to maintain a portable form factor while also contributing to low-light performance and depth of field control complimenting the slightly longer focal length. Its all-metal body, which is a feature across all I series lenses, and the design with great care paid to the touch and even how delightful the sound made during operation is will make the lens a joy to use and own.
- Use of multiple high-precision aspherical glass molded lenses - SIGMA uses high-precision molds whose surfaces are controlled with an accuracy of ±5 nanometers (0.000005 mm) or smaller. High-precision aspherical glass molded lenses archives both good aberration correction and compact lens size.
- Magnetic metal lens cap - The I series lenses* are accompanied by a dedicated magnetic metal lens cap, in addition to a normal plastic cap. This dedicated metal cap clips to the front surface of the lens magnetically. It is no exaggeration to say that this meticulously crafted cap represents the finishing touch for the I series.
- Stepping Motor - The lens is capable of smooth, quiet, and high-speed AF made possible by a stepping motor, as well as supports Face/Eye Detection AF and video AF.
- Mount with Dust and Splash Resistant Structure - The lens mount incorporates rubber sealing to protect the mount from dust and water drops.
- Super Multi-Layer Coating - In digital cameras, flare and ghosting may also be caused by reflections between the image sensor and lens surfaces. Here too, SIGMA’s Super Multi-Layer Coating is highly effective, assuring images of outstanding contrast.
- Aperture ring - Designed to help users work intuitively.
- Focus Mode Switch - Using this switch, it is possible to switch the focus mode between AF and MF.
- Linear focus / Non-linear focus - With “non-linear focus,” the amount of focal point movement varies depending on the focus ring rotational speed. With linear focus, if the focus ring rotational angle is the same, the amount of focal point movement remains the same regardless of the focus ring rotational speed.
- Supports DMF, AF+MF
- Inner focus
- 9-blade rounded diaphragm
- High-precision, durable brass bayonet mount
Lens Construction | 12 elements in 9 groups |
Angle of View | 36.8° |
Number of Diaphragm Blades | 9 (rounded diaphragm) |
Minimum Aperture | F22 |
Minimum Focusing Distance |
55cm / 21.7in.
|
Maximum Magnification Ratio |
1:6.8
|
Filter Size |
φ62mm
|
Dimensions (Diameter × Length) |
φ72mm × 74.7mm / φ2.8in. × 2.9in.
*The length of a lens is measured from the filter surface to its mount.
|
Weight |
405g / 14.3oz.
|
Supplied Accessories |
Magnetic metal lens cap FRONT CAP LCF62-01M, Lens Hood (LH636-01) included
